A blucher is a type of shoe with open lacing, often considered similar to a derby shoe, usually made of leather and worn for both formal and smart-casual occasions.

"Blucher" is a formal and technical term often used in fashion, shoe retail, or bespoke tailoring. It can be confused with "derby", though in American English they're often considered the same. Rare in casual speech; more common in style discussions or dress codes.
